Tickler is a custom multi-stage backdoor used by the Iranian state-sponsored threat actor Peach Sandstorm, also referred to in the content as APT33 / Refined Kitten / Curious Serpens. Microsoft observed it deployed between April and July 2024 in campaigns targeting organizations in the satellite, communications equipment, oil and gas, and U.S. federal, state, and local government sectors, including victims in the United States and the United Arab Emirates. The activity is assessed to support Iranian intelligence collection interests and is linked to the IRGC. Tickler has also been described in the content as used against defense, energy, telecom, space, and government-related targets, including a compromised U.S. local government.
The malware is described as a custom multi-stage backdoor that collects initial host and network information, communicates with attacker-controlled Azure resources, and uses fraudulent or compromised Azure subscriptions and Azure App Service for command and control. Microsoft observed Peach Sandstorm using compromised education-sector accounts to access existing Azure subscriptions or create new Azure infrastructure used as Tickler C2 or operational hop points. Tickler was observed beaconing to Azure-hosted infrastructure to download additional payloads, including a backdoor, a persistence-setting batch script, legitimate Windows-signed binaries likely used for DLL sideloading, and malicious DLLs.
Observed delivery and execution details include an archive named "Network Security.zip" containing benign PDF decoys and a file named "YAHSAT NETWORK_INFRASTRUCTURE_SECURITY_GUIDE_20240421.pdf.exe," a 64-bit C/C++ PE sample. The initial sample launched a benign PDF decoy, resolved APIs from kernel32.dll via PEB traversal, collected host network information, and sent it to C2 via HTTP POST. A later sample, "sold.dll," acted as a Trojan dropper that downloaded additional components. Persistence was established via a batch script adding a registry Run key for "SharePoint.exe." The malware is also described as using legitimate Windows binaries to evade detection and establish persistence.
Tickler supports typical backdoor functionality including host and network discovery, directory listing, command execution, file deletion, configurable beacon interval changes, and file upload/download. Explicitly reported commands include systeminfo, dir, run, delete, interval, upload, and download. Legitimate signed files downloaded in observed activity included msvcp140.dll, LoggingPlatform.dll, vcruntime140.dll, and Microsoft.SharePoint.NativeMessaging.exe. High-confidence indicators directly mentioned in the content include the filenames "YAHSAT NETWORK_INFRASTRUCTURE_SECURITY_GUIDE_20240421.pdf.exe" and "sold.dll," the archive "Network Security.zip," and the persistence artifact of a registry Run key for "SharePoint.exe."
